Published in the year 2004, Disraeli, Gladstone & the Eastern Question is a valuable contribution to the field of History.
Chapter 1 Disraeli and the new Imperialism; Chapter 2 The Eastern Crisis; Chapter 3 The Bulgarian Atrocities; Chapter 4 The Conference of Constantinople; Chapter 5 The Battle in Parliament; Chapter 6 The Russo-Turkish War; Chapter 7 The Growth of Cabinet Dissensions; Chapter 8 The Final Breach; Chapter 9 Salisbury at the Foreign Office; Chapter 10 The Congress of Berlin; Chapter 11 The Treaty of Berlin and its Results; Chapter 12 “Peace with Honour”: from Berlin to Midlothian;
